KROL, Gary Alfred
July 18, 1946 - February 6, 2018
With heavy hearts we announce that Gary passed away at the Foothills Hospital in Calgary, AB after a brief battle with cancer. He will be deeply missed by Peggy (nee Enns), his loving wife of 43 years; his son Jacob (Alyssa Butters); his sister Maureen Peirce (Jim); and his half-brother Oliver. Gary is predeceased by his son Matthew. Gary spent 40 years in different aspects of both the residential and commercial construction industries. These included a variety of roles in everything from framing houses to project manager in downtown high rises. He was also a co-owner with Peggy in Traditions - a country store in Cochrane for 24 years. Gary had a great love for baseball as both a coach and a fan. He also had a keen interest in fishing. He spent many enjoyable days both locally on Alberta trout streams, and in later years on the Gulf of Mexico in Florida. Gary was highly devoted to his family, always doing everything he could to provide for his wife and two sons.
